Abdul WahabandCursor 5d7c1cce34 Fix: inherit DESIGN.md only from a monorepo root that owns the path (#570)
findDesignRoot continued past every workspace package.json to any
workspace-declaring ancestor. It now matches the boundary against that
ancestor's globs (including negations and globstars), so excluded and
stray packages do not inherit, while included workspaces still do.

/**
* Regression for issue #570: design-system rules must reach a monorepo workspace
* by inheriting the repo root's DESIGN.md.
*
* Run with: node --test tests/detect-cli-design-monorepo.test.mjs
*/
